Exercise Relieves Stress  Deal with life’s frustrations by exercising Muay Thai, Cardio Kickboxing, Weight Training, Running, yoga A means to release negative emotions Makes one more capable to cope with current stress and life’s future stress Less stress – happier person Release stress hormones  Use exercise as therapy Exercise in different types of places Does not have to be in just a gym Let stress be your motivation!

Endorphins Affect Your Mood  Not only do you relieve stress but your mood improves too!  Exercise decreases stress hormones, releases endorphins  Also released are adrenaline, serotonin, and dopamine Combination of “feel good chemicals” “Runner’s High” Cortisol Endorphins
